From one of my favourite sites, the Consumerist, comes the 10 Commandments of Credit. Mainly rules for how to avoid debt and live a healthy life — economically speaking.
Here’s one to get you started. The site has more details.
9) Thou Shalt Not Cancel Credit Cards, Thou Shalt Try To Keep Them Open So As Not To Shorten Thine Credit History.
